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en Hialeah Gardens

Cuál es el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más barato en Hialeah Gardens?

Actualmente el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más accequible en Hialeah Gardens está en Northeast Point Properties listado en $1,500.

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Hialeah Gardens?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Hialeah Gardens es $2,305.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en Hialeah Gardens?

A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en Hialeah Gardens una unidad de 1,435 a partir de $2,256 en Palmera.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en Hialeah Gardens?

El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en Hialeah Gardens es actualmente de 765 sq ft.
